Our year is nearly half over. It sure passed fast. A new issue I have become aware of is related to the termite inspection and the termite inspector. There has been a lot of controversy about wether the "termite" man is searching for work, or doing a proper report. And about the "new" orange treatment. Having jumped into the middle of this in a sale, I researched. What I found is interesting.

When you search the "structual pest control board" in the state of California, and key word "orange" you find a lot of comments in the annual meeting. They are basically negative. They say the "orange" people are giving false advertizement. They say the spot treatment will not get rid of all the termites, and if you find more, they are "new". What I could not find is if they can certify a "section one clearance". If they can do that, then they are a valid treatment. Always ask questions!

The other issue is if the termite inspector is just making work. We do not crawl under with them, and a lot of things they point out are minute. I do remember our association discussing that very fact, and that the free report was the first red flag. I am not sure, but I thought that you had to use someone else to do the "repairs", not the inspecting company. That is something I will follow up on as I want to be informed.
